The Andy Griffith Show remains a timeless cornerstone of classic American television, a heartwarming portrait of small-town life in the fictional Mayberry, North Carolina. Airing from 1960 to 1968, the series introduced us to Sheriff Andy Taylor, his son Opie, and a host of unforgettable characters who defined a generation of wholesome comedy.

As of December 10, 2025, the passage of time means that most of the primary, beloved adult cast members, including Andy Griffith (Andy Taylor), Don Knotts (Barney Fife), and Frances Bavier (Aunt Bee), have passed away. However, a few key actors—particularly the child stars—are still with us, and their lives today are a fascinating blend of Hollywood history and modern endeavors, with one main cast member still dominating the director's chair in Tinseltown.

The Main Cast of The Andy Griffith Show: A Complete Biography

The core ensemble of The Andy Griffith Show created a magical dynamic that is rarely replicated. Here is a look at the principal cast members and their time in Mayberry.

  • Andy Griffith (Sheriff Andy Taylor): The kind, widowed sheriff and moral center of Mayberry.
    • Born: June 1, 1926
    • Died: July 3, 2012
  • Don Knotts (Deputy Barney Fife): Andy’s nervous, bumbling, yet endearing cousin and deputy.
    • Born: July 21, 1924
    • Died: February 24, 2006
  • Ron Howard (Opie Taylor): Andy’s young, red-headed son, who often learned life lessons from his father and Aunt Bee.
    • Born: March 1, 1954
    • Status: Still Alive
  • Frances Bavier (Aunt Bee Taylor): Andy’s paternal aunt and housekeeper who provided motherly guidance to Andy and Opie.
    • Born: December 14, 1902
    • Died: December 6, 1989
  • Aneta Corsaut (Helen Crump): Opie’s schoolteacher and later Andy’s wife in the Return to Mayberry TV movie.
    • Born: November 3, 1933
    • Died: November 6, 1995
  • Jim Nabors (Gomer Pyle): The naive, sweet-natured gas station attendant who later got his own spin-off, Gomer Pyle, U.S.M.C.
    • Born: June 12, 1930
    • Died: November 30, 2017
  • Betty Lynn (Thelma Lou): Barney Fife's sweet, long-suffering girlfriend.
    • Born: August 29, 1926
    • Died: October 15, 2021

The Mayberry Survivors: Ron Howard’s Blockbusters and Other Cast Updates

The most prominent surviving member of the main cast is, without a doubt, the actor who played Opie Taylor. While the show is a cherished memory, the post-Mayberry careers of the surviving cast members are arguably just as legendary.

Ron Howard (Opie Taylor)

Ron Howard, who played Opie Taylor for all eight seasons, is the only primary cast member still alive. After the show, he transitioned seamlessly from child star to teen idol on Happy Days (as Richie Cunningham) and then to an Oscar-winning director and producer.

Today, Ron Howard, who recently turned 70, is one of Hollywood’s most prolific filmmakers.

  • Current Projects (2025/2026): Howard is actively directing and producing new films. His upcoming projects include "Alone At Dawn," a military drama for Amazon MGM Studios, which is an adaptation of a non-fiction book about a U.S. Air Force pararescueman. He is also working on a film titled "Eden," which is described as his first true crime thriller.
  • Legacy: His directorial credits include blockbusters like Apollo 13, A Beautiful Mind (for which he won the Academy Award for Best Director), and The Da Vinci Code.

Elinor Donahue (Ellie Walker)

Elinor Donahue played Ellie Walker, the town pharmacist and Andy's initial love interest, appearing in the first season. Before Mayberry, she was famous as Betty Anderson on Father Knows Best.

Donahue, who is now in her late 80s, has been retired from acting for some time, enjoying a peaceful life away from the spotlight. Her early departure from The Andy Griffith Show was reportedly due to a lack of chemistry with Andy Griffith's character, but her role remains a memorable part of the show's early history.

What Happened to Mayberry’s Other Child Stars?

While Opie was the star child, The Andy Griffith Show featured a rotating cast of Opie’s friends, many of whom have completely left the world of acting to pursue different lives. Their stories are a fascinating glimpse into the lives of non-mainstream child actors.

Richard Keith (Johnny Paul Jason)

Richard Keith, born Keith Thibodeaux, is a unique figure in classic television history. He is best known for playing Little Ricky Ricardo on I Love Lucy and The Lucy-Desi Comedy Hour, but he also appeared as Opie's friend, Johnny Paul Jason, in several episodes of The Andy Griffith Show.

Today, Thibodeaux is a musician (a talented drummer) and is involved in ministry. He often attends Mayberry-themed fan events and festivals, sharing stories of his time on both iconic shows.

Dennis Rush (Howie Pruitt)

Dennis Rush played Howie Pruitt, one of Opie's close friends and a recurring character in eight episodes. Rush left Hollywood when he was 15 years old, choosing a life outside of show business.

Like Keith Thibodeaux, Rush sometimes makes appearances at Mayberry events, connecting with fans of the classic series.

Sheldon Collins (Arnold Bailey)

Sheldon Collins, sometimes credited as Sheldon Golomb, played Arnold Bailey, another of Opie's friends. Collins had a short but notable acting career, which included a role in the original Star Trek series. He is largely out of the public eye today, having left the entertainment industry after his childhood roles.

The Enduring Legacy of Mayberry and Topical Authority

The continued interest in the whereabouts of the Andy Griffith Show cast, even decades after the show ended, speaks to its powerful and enduring topical authority. The show is not just a comedy; it’s a cultural touchstone representing American nostalgia, morality, and simpler times. The theme of Sheriff Andy Taylor raising his son with wisdom, guided by the loving presence of Aunt Bee and the comic relief of Barney Fife, resonates deeply with new generations.

The Mayberry universe has expanded far beyond the original series, including the sequel film Return to Mayberry and the spin-off Gomer Pyle, U.S.M.C. The annual Mayberry Days festival in Andy Griffith’s real-life hometown of Mount Airy, North Carolina, continues to draw thousands of devoted fans, proving that the spirit of Mayberry lives on, even as its original cast members fade into history. The surviving cast members, especially Ron Howard, keep the memory fresh with their continued careers and occasional retrospective interviews about the beloved series.
